The inclusion of fluorine atoms in drug molecules is a widely adopted strategy to enhance their metabolic stability, increase lipophilicity, and improve receptor binding. 1-Bromo-4-(1,1-difluoroethyl)benzene provides a direct route to incorporate such beneficial fluorinated moieties. As a key component in API synthesis, its quality directly impacts the purity and efficacy of the final therapeutic product.
